Volvo XC90: Driver support / Steering assistance at risk of collision

The Collision avoidance function can help the driver reduce the risk of the vehicle leaving its lane unintentionally and/or colliding with another vehicle or obstacle by actively steering the vehicle back into its lane and/or swerving.

The function consists of these subfunctions:

  • Run-Off Mitigation with steering assistance
  • Steering assistance during collision risks from oncoming traffic
  • Steering assistance during collision risks from behind*

After the system has automatically intervened, this text message will appear in the instrument panel:

Collision avoidance – Automatic intervention

WARNING

  • The function is supplementary driver support intended to facilitate driving and help make it safer – it cannot handle all situations in all traffic, weather and road conditions.
  • The driver is advised to read all sections in the Owner's Manual about this function to learn of its limitations, which the driver must be aware of before using the function.
  • Driver support functions are not a substitute for the driver's attention and judgment. The driver is always responsible for ensuring the vehicle is driven in a safe manner, at the appropriate speed, with an appropriate distance to other vehicles, and in accordance with current traffic rules and regulations.

NOTE

It is always the driver who must decide how much the vehicle should be in control – the vehicle can never take command.
